Details
A vulnerability was found in PTW-WMS1 2.000.012. It has been declared as critical. This vulnerability affects an unknown code block of the component Access Restriction.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a access control v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-284. The product does not restrict or incorrectly restricts access to a resource from an unauthorized actor. As an impact it is known to affect confidentiality, integrity, and availability. CVE summarizes:
PTW-WMS1 firmware version 2.000.012 allows remote attackers to bypass access restrictions to obtain or delete data on the disk via unspecified vectors.
The bug was discovered 11/13/2017. The weakness was disclosed 12/01/2017 (Website). The advisory is available at jvn.jp. This vulnerability was named CVE-2017-10900 since 07/04/2017. The exploitation appears to be easy. The attack can be initiated remotely. No form of authentication is required for a successful exploitation.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not available. This vulnerability is assigned to T1068 by the MITRE ATT&CK project.
The vulnerability was handled as a non-public zero-day exploit for at least 18 days. During that time the estimated underground price was around $0-$5k.
There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
